2018 Dining Room Decor: Trends and Inspirations
The dining room, once solely a space for formal gatherings, has evolved into a hub of social interaction and culinary exploration. In 2018, dining room decor trends reflect this shift, emphasizing comfort, functionality, and personal style. From bold colors and eclectic accents to minimalist designs and natural materials, the options are abundant for creating a dining space that is both inviting and stylish.
Embrace the Power of Color
Gone are the days of beige walls and predictable color palettes. 2018 embraces bold color choices in dining room decor. Rich jewel tones like emerald green, sapphire blue, and ruby red inject personality and vibrancy into the space. Consider using these colors on walls, furniture, or even accent pieces. A deep teal dining set can create a dramatic focal point, while a vibrant burnt orange rug adds warmth and a touch of whimsy.
For those who prefer a more subtle approach, incorporating pops of color through accessories and artwork can still make a statement. A collection of colorful ceramic bowls on a dining room table, a vibrant floral arrangement on a buffet, or a gallery wall of abstract paintings can all bring life and energy to a neutral backdrop.
Embrace the Eclectic Aesthetic
The curated, eclectic look is gaining traction in 2018. Forget about matching furniture sets and perfectly symmetrical arrangements. Instead, embrace a mix-and-match approach, incorporating pieces from different eras and styles to create a unique and personal space. A vintage farmhouse table paired with modern chairs, a mid-century buffet with a rustic bench, and a collection of antique ceramics on open shelves all contribute to an eclectic ambiance.
This style celebrates individuality and allows for the expression of personal tastes. It’s a chance to create a dining room that tells a story, reflecting your travels, passions, and interests. Adding vintage maps, antique silverware, or family heirlooms to the mix adds a personal touch and creates a space that is both visually engaging and meaningful.
The Appeal of Natural Materials
Natural materials like wood, stone, and leather are key elements in 2018 dining room decor. Their earthy tones and organic textures bring a sense of warmth and tranquility to the space. A solid wood dining table serves as a timeless centerpiece, while a rustic stone fireplace adds architectural interest and cozy ambiance. Leather chairs and benches contribute to a sense of durability and comfort, inviting guests to linger and enjoy the company.
Incorporating natural elements in smaller details enhances the overall feel of the space. A collection of potted plants on a shelf, a wicker basket filled with linens, or a hand-woven rug add textural interest and a touch of nature. The use of these materials not only creates a visually pleasing aesthetic but also promotes a sense of well-being and connection to the natural world.
Illuminating the Dining Experience
Lighting plays a crucial role in setting the mood and enhancing the dining experience. In 2018, a layered approach to lighting is key for creating a warm and inviting ambiance. A statement chandelier above the dining table provides a dramatic focal point, while sconces on the walls offer soft, ambient light. Recessed lighting can be used to illuminate specific areas, while table lamps add a touch of personality and provide functional light for reading or conversation.
Consider incorporating dimmer switches for adjustable lighting levels, allowing for versatile ambiance adjustments. Dim the lights for a romantic dinner, or brighten them up for a lively gathering. The right lighting can transform the dining room from a simple space to a captivating and intimate experience.
The Importance of Functionality
While aesthetics are essential, functionality remains a priority in 2018 dining room decor. The space should be both stylish and practical, catering to the needs of the family and facilitating enjoyable dining experiences. Consider incorporating storage solutions such as a built-in buffet, a stylish bar cart, or open shelving to keep clutter at bay and create a sense of order. Durable materials and easy-to-clean surfaces are also important factors in maximizing functionality, especially in homes with children or active lifestyles.
Incorporating a mix of seating options can further enhance the functionality of the dining room. Benches provide a comfortable, casual seating option, while chairs can be chosen for their comfort and style.
